Our own study of 4,330 college football games found wind alone showed no material scoring deviation, so we keep these reads descriptive — conditions and context, not exaggerated edge claims.

    What the research says

    The published studies behind the read on this page at FirstBank Stadium. Every figure is season-adjusted, with sample sizes and t-statistics shown.

    • College Football Wind & Kicking

      Crosswind — resolved against each venue's true field bearing — bends field-goal accuracy. Game totals show no material deviation.

      4,330 games

    • College Football Heat & Humidity Shock

      Do cool-climate teams underperform when they travel into hot, humid Southern venues in August and September? Graded against closing lines, with control games alongside.

      Ten seasons of Aug–Sept road games

    • College Football Extreme Heat & Totals

      A widely repeated claim says non-conference games go Over about 59% of the time at 85–106°F. Our data: 52.8% against a 49.1% control — no meaningful edge.

      Ten seasons of kickoff-hour temperatures graded against closing totals

    • College Football Rain & Totals

      Rain does not measurably move college football scoring. Wet games sit within a fraction of a point of dry games once each season is accounted for, and the Over rate barely shifts.

      1,441 outdoor games with closing totals, 2016–2025 (211 wet)
